How is the weather in Bayfield?
Bayfield features cold winters, with temperatures around 22–35°F (-6–1°C), and warm summers, reaching 76–82°F (25–28°C). Spring and fall have milder conditions, making outdoor activities comfortable.

What is Bayfield known for?
Bayfield is known for its welcoming small-town atmosphere, access to outdoor recreation along the Pine River, and ties to agriculture. The area has a mix of local festivals, fishing spots, and scenic natural landscapes.
